Blackpool Adult Social Care is looking for committed, caring, and enthusiastic Social Workers to join our hospital and community-based teams. This is a fantastic opportunity to be part of a large, supportive service working closely with health and community partners to improve outcomes for the people of Blackpool.
We are proud to be on an exciting transformation journey, with our teams recently externally audited and recognised as a beacon of good practice, particularly for our strengths in:
About the Role
You will be part of a multi-disciplinary teamworking collaboratively with health and care professionals across Blackpool. Your work will support adults and carers to remain safe, well, and as independent as possible within their own homes and communities.
